Tafelmusik is thrilled to launch Musik in Motion: a free series of collaborative videos produced by Puncture Design, featuring local artists of diverse art forms. In keeping with our commitment to exploring “baroque and beyond,” Tafelmusik invited five creative partners to interpret music that is an essential part of Tafelmusik’s signature repertoire.

The series launches with a video featuring painter Darby Milbrath. In Studio with Darby Milbrath follows the completion of a painting, featuring visceral close ups of the artist’s movements, dabs, and gestures—all created while she listened to Tafelmusik’s recording of Vivaldi's Violin Concerto in C Minor, RV 761 “Amato bene”, featuring soloist and Music Director Elisa Citterio.

Musik in Motion videos will premiere once a month, and forthcoming collaborations feature visual artist Alex McLeod, Tafelmusik cellist Keiran Campbell, and the School of Toronto Dance Theatre with choreographer Hanna Kiel.
